HC Deb 06 December 1920 vol 135 cc1740-1W
Mr. A. HERBERT

asked the Minister of Pensions whether disabled men may be informed as to the artificial limbs that have been ordered for them, in order that they may have the opportunity to state whether such artificial limbs are likely to be useful in their own case or not?

Major TRYON

Pensioners are allowed to choose any limb in the Ministry's Approved List which is suitable from a surgical point of view.
